Biennials

By

Biennials live for approximately two growing seasons, make seeds, and then die.

This list came from Horticulture: The Art and Science of Smart Gardening website.  This is just a list of popular biennials and not a complete list.  I encourage you to do a little research into these kinds of flowers.  Some biennials are grown as annuals like the Blue Bedder; while others are grown as perennials such as the Delphinium ‘Centurion Sky Blue’.   It pays to do a little research and find out which is which because some biennials will re-seed themselves acting as perennials, but you don’t want to be surprised by an annual when it blooms the second year and then suddenly dies back and never returns.
